Techno‐Economic Analysis of Hydrocarbon‐CO2 Binary Mixtures in Heat Pump‐Based Thermal Energy Storages

open access: yesEnergy Technology, Volume 14, Issue 4, April 2026.
Heat‐pump charging of Carnot batteries with zeotropic large temperature glide CO2–alkane mixtures enables charging from ambient to ≈398.15 K with improved heat‐exchanger temperature matching at moderate pressure ratios. The highest COP occurs near xCO2 ≈ 0.15, whereas cost and throttling losses rise monotonically with CO2 content; butane isomers ...

Opportunities for Multiscale Pattern Modulation with Temporally Arrested Breath Figures

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, Volume 13, Issue 5, 4 March 2026.
This works presents the temporally arrested breath figure methodology and its opportunities for pattern modulation. Through thermodynamic and photochemical phase change handles, this method uses drop‐wise condensation as a dynamic template for fast, accessible and scalable micropatterning.

A Model‐Based Interpretation for the Apparently Homogeneous Steam Bubble Nucleation in Industrial Evaporative Sucrose Crystallization

open access: yesJournal of Food Process Engineering, Volume 49, Issue 3, March 2026.
A model has been developed and validated with data from the sugar industry to determine the evaporation rate of discontinuous evaporating crystallizers. The results indicate that vapor nucleation on the surface of sucrose crystals is a significant factor, particularly in the context of low temperature differences in the calandria.
